Agency Name: Kazakhstan USAID-Almaty
Description: The United States Government (USG), as represented by the United States Agency for International Development (USAID) is seeking applications from local Non-Governmental Organizations (LNGOs), local For-Profit Organizations, local Colleges and Universities to implement a four year program entitled Good Governance Initiative Fund program. The authority for the RFA is found in the Foreign Assistance Act of 1961, as amended. The primary goal of this activity is to identify and support the creativity and innovation inherent in civil society organizations and communities in Kazakhstan and Tajikistan in order to achieve institutionalized, permanent and durable reforms on particular good governance topics. The vision behind the Good Governance Initiative Fund is to foster strong civil society partnerships and advocacy to challenge and enable governments to deliver on their promise of good governance. The Recipient will be responsible for ensuring achievement of the program objectives. Please refer to Section I, the “Funding Opportunity Description” for a complete statement of goals and expected results. Subject to the availability of funds, USAID intends to provide approximately $6,700,000 – $8,040,000 in total USAID funding allocated over the four-year period. USAID reserves the right to fund any or none of the applications submitted.
